People using at least basic drinking water services (% of) in Lao People's Democratic Republic
Lao People's Democratic Republic: People using at least basic drinking water services (% of) was 67.7% in 2017. ▲ Rising
People using at least basic drinking water services (% of) in Lao People's Democratic Republic, 2000–2017
Source: WHO/UNICEF Joint Monitoring Programme (JMP) for Water Supply, Sanitation and Hygiene (washdata.org). Measured in lowest.
Analysis
Lao People's Democratic Republic recorded 67.7% for people using at least basic drinking water services (% of) in 2017. That is the highest value across all 18 years on record.
That represents a change of up 4.1% on the previous year and up 65.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, people using at least basic drinking water services (% of) in Lao People's Democratic Republic peaked at 67.7% in 2017 and was at its lowest, 22.1%, in 2000.
That places Lao People's Democratic Republic 53rd out of 97 countries with data for 2017,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 18 years of available data.
People using at least basic drinking water services (% of) in Lao People's Democratic Republic, year by year
| Year | lowest |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2000 | 22.1% | — |
| 2001 | 24.8% | +12.1% |
| 2002 | 27.5% | +10.8% |
| 2003 | 30.2% | +9.8% |
| 2004 | 32.9% | +8.9% |
| 2005 | 35.5% | +8.2% |
| 2006 | 38.2% | +7.5% |
| 2007 | 40.9% | +7.0% |
| 2008 | 43.6% | +6.6% |
| 2009 | 46.3% | +6.2% |
| 2010 | 49.0% | +5.8% |
| 2011 | 51.6% | +5.5% |
| 2012 | 54.3% | +5.2% |
| 2013 | 57.0% | +4.9% |
| 2014 | 59.7% | +4.7% |
| 2015 | 62.4% | +4.5% |
| 2016 | 65.0% | +4.3% |
| 2017 | 67.7% | +4.1% |
